Sei venuto qui per conoscere Redux; Sembra che tu stia imparando a conoscere lo sviluppo del front-end o vuoi con impazienza di eccellere in JavaScript. Questo articolo coprirà i seguenti punti, quindi assicurati di rimanere con noi fino alla fine per conoscere Redux.
Quindi immergiamoci nell'introduzione di Redux First.
Cosa è Redux?
Rif significa riguardare, e Dux significa leader. Quindi, come suggerisce il nome, Redux è una delle biblioteche luci e più calde che guidano il mondo nei tempi attuali riguardanti il dominio front-end. Appartiene all'insieme di librerie JavaScript. La specialità di Redux è che è un contenitore di stato prevedibile che aiuta a gestire lo stato dell'applicazione.
Ora, come conosciamo il concetto di base di Redux, vediamo i benefici che derivano dall'uso di Redux.
Quali sono i vantaggi dell'utilizzo di Redux?
Alcuni dei vantaggi offerti da Redux nelle nostre applicazioni sono i seguenti:
Quindi, sappiamo cos'è Redux e perché dovremmo usarlo. Ora sorge la domanda su dove possiamo usare Redux.
Dove possiamo usare Redux?
Redux offre un meccanismo unico per integrarlo con diversi framework o piattaforme, in particolare con react e react-nativo, ma non limitato. Può anche essere abbandonato in JS angolare, angolare e mithril.
Se hai raggiunto qui, supponiamo che tu abbia attraversato l'introduzione di base di Redux sopra menzionata. Aspettare; C'è ancora molto di più su Redux che dovresti sapere per una migliore introduzione.
Ora apprendiamo i componenti di Redux, cosa sono e come lavorano insieme.
Quali sono i componenti dell'edificio di Redux?
Redux è un contenitore che contiene i seguenti componenti ”:
La figura sopra descrive come funziona un redux in un'applicazione. Prende l'evento o l'azione dall'interfaccia utente e lo trasmette al riduttore. Il riduttore prende lo stato attuale, applica questo evento o azione e passa un nuovo stato come output. Questo stato di output viene quindi salvato nel negozio dell'applicazione.
Ora abbiamo finito di introdurre Redux, i suoi benefici e i suoi componenti interni. Non pensi che dovremmo provare un semplice esercizio di codifica per questo?
Conclusione
Redux viene utilizzato per ottimizzare le prestazioni di grandi applicazioni. Questo articolo dimostra l'introduzione di redux, vantaggi, utilizzo e componenti dell'edificio di Redux. È utile rendere l'applicazione facile da testare e eseguire il debug. Quindi, hai sperimentato la conoscenza di Redux che contiene le librerie di JavaScript.